Here are some key project planning techniques to explore:
* **Work Breakdown Structure (WBS):** Fragment complex projects into smaller, manageable tasks.
* **Gantt Charts:** Visualize project schedules and task dependencies in a clear manner.
* **Critical Path Method (CPM):** Determine the sequence of critical tasks that principally impact project completion time.
* **PERT Charts:** Assess project uncertainty by accounting for task durations with a range of possible values.

Understanding Critical Path Analysis in Project Management
Critical path analysis is a powerful project management technique used to identify the sequence of tasks that most significantly impact the overall project duration. By analyzing the relationships between tasks and their dependencies, this method highlights the critical path, which represents the longest sequence of activities that influences the minimum possible project completion time. Understanding the critical path allows project managers to allocate resources effectively, track progress closely, and resolve potential delays before they substantially affect the project timeline.
